    Ima be real Gojo's hype made sense, he was in a time period where no one was close to him, his actual existence is considered different and even linked to fate in the society. Sukuna's hype is being given to us in the same time period where Gojo existed, it comes off fake and misplaced. A Heian Arc is where that hype should be, where the other sorcerers around are also on a greater level thus elevating that hype. Kashimo's remarks about Sukuna's curse energy manipulation were good yet not on Gojo's level, why put that in a time period where no one even has curse energy control comparable to either and please don't say Higrumua lmao. Sukuna's domain as a divine technique is said by narrator, I think if it came from a Heian era sorcerer in a Heian Arc it would've been so much cooler. Maybe Gege could've shown us what got Sukuna his King of Curses title, not just tell us. You look at the greats in manga like Naruto, Bleach or Op they hype their top dogs and give us flashbacks, Madara and Hashirama hype? We saw that, we saw what set them apart from other ninjas. Minato hype? We saw Minato fight Nine tails and Obito, saw him almost kill Bee and Ay. White Beard? we see him and Gol fight . Gege wants to gas him up? Show us him fighting at his strongest, against others worth it, against others deemed the strongest era, not a bunch of first grades and one special grade. He's tryna flex how good Sukuna is against sorcerers with little training in their life. Maki? Been put down since a kid and neglected by her clan. Yuta? this is first year really doing anything after 6 months of training lmao. Yuji.... 7 months. Ino? Kusakabe? Random first grades with nothing to show. Higuruma? less than two months. Look at Aizen and Madara, they fought real niggas, really built for battle and trained their life, knew what it was going into it and showed the difference in power and skill. We just aren't seeing that here, like at all. Its been non-stop: say this character impressed Sukuna, then get rid of them. Harm Sukuna more, and still show he's able to fight them. Nerf Sukuna here, then praise him more for his jujutsu skill. All we needed for Aizen was Gin talking about how strong he was for hype and then Aizen showed it against strong characters. Tsundade told us Madara's very name was power and then we saw what Madara meant. You say King of Curses and you bring up him fighting Gojo and then having to contextualize the battle as "well he actually didn't just beat Gojo all by himself, he had Mahoraga help out a lot" its just not the same and its why Sukuna's aura and character suffer from not having a Heian Arc to give us all that hype. Imagine we got shown younger Sukuna facing a powerful Heian era sorcerer and Sukuna actually struggles due to the guy being strong and having a good ct like Gojo but he ends up winning through his first barrier-less domain? We're missing out on big moments of Sukuna's hype, the stuff that made him what he is and it just doesn't feel like we're reading about the strongest, just Gege's favorite.
